Variables within variables

Hi everyone,

 

let me give you guys some context first. I own a detailing business and I'm trying to set up my prices. The only problem is prices depend on what size your car is. So I have what service customers want, what package customers want, and what car type their car is.

 

For example, my customers choose interior only detail, then they choose my basic package, and then they select their car type.

 

Is there a way I could do this? If so how, and if not is there an alternative?

I think you just need to change the order they select things in.  The item would be the service they want, then each variation would be the vehicle type, and then the modifier would be the package.  Whatever makes most sense.  When you get to the package I would make the most basic package be preselected and 0.00$.  Then as the packages upgrade you would add the difference.  So if basic package is included start with 0 there.  If silver package is next and costs 5$ more just do the 5.00 as the modifier cost as it adds on.

 

If you wanted to really globally do it, and not sure this would be best.  The item would be the size of car, the variation would be the package, and modifier the service or vice versa.

 

You could really do this well with options for a nice website experience.  You would have a couple different option sets that would populate all of the variations for you.  But the nice thing about this would be you would only have 3 or 4 items to track and it would be very scripted.  Same principle just do modifiers as the add on pricing you need to make it all work out.
